One thing future travelers should be aware of — and this is absolutely not the fault of Beyond Travel — is that the border crossing between Uganda and Rwanda can be somewhat slow, unclear, and chaotic. Unfortunately, we lost quite a bit of valuable time during the process on what was already a shorter two-night trekking experience. Hopefully others will have a smoother experience than we did. Looking back, I also wish I had purchased a multiple-entry Uganda visa, but that was my oversight, not theirs.
